  1. Emanuel Hoffmann (4 May 1896 – 3 October 1932) was a Swiss jurist and art collector. He was the son of Fritz Hoffmann-La Roche, a founder of the pharmaceutical company Hoffmann-La Roche (also known as Roche), and his first wife.

  3. After more than 80 years of collecting contemporary art, the Emanuel Hoffmann Foundation holds paintings, sculptures, installations, video works and films by over 150 artists. Many of the works that entered the collection early on – such as those by Robert Delaunay, Paul Klee, Max Ernst or Hans Arp – now rank among the classics of Modernism.

  4. Emanuel Hoffmann Foundation. The Emanuel Hoffmann Foundation was established in 1933 by Maja Hoffmann-Stehlin, the later Maja Sacher-Stehlin, (1896–1989), to continue the commitment to contemporary art which she and her husband, who passed away young, had begun.
